Marvel Adventures Fantastic Four #36
In "Understudy Rumble," the Fantastic Four lend their expertise to a film project led by a professor friend of Reed's, only to find themselves facing off against a former student whose experimental invention has turned her classmates into unexpected super-powered adversaries. Written by Paul Tobin and illustrated by David Hahn, with vibrant colors by Guillem Mari and sharp lettering by Nate Piekos, this 2008 adventure blends science, suspense, and a touch of cinematic flair. The cover by Dennis Calero captures the chaos in bold, dynamic detail.
